Output fb61c9f86734e0e58b1c35f3a25131f11df952fd74f9d8306fbfa7d2b392607a:2

value
29470000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3048362440462e8b6cdccb4c8776107a2ec479 OP_EQUAL
address
3P8aZKbKehLVmvZ5QBYQK95ZE8fMyYuHhB
transaction
fb61c9f86734e0e58b1c35f3a25131f11df952fd74f9d8306fbfa7d2b392607a
confirmations
455781
spent
true